Madden Industrial Craftsmen is seeking to fill a Welding Supervisor role for our client, a leading manufacturer of high-quality medical devices. This position carries overall responsibility for a team of 30+ TIG, MIG, and Spot Welders and assistants across two shifts and reports directly to the Production Manager. This is a direct hire opportunity.
Duties and Responsibilities:
Provide top-level leadership for both shifts of welding operations
Prioritize and direct workflow within the welding department to support interdependent departments
Promote individual productivity and drive the welding team to meet department goals
Ensure quality checks are completed and report non-conformances to maintain quality standards
Ensure production transaction accuracy within the ERP system
Collaborate with the Production Manager and other Supervisors to optimize overall production output
Evaluate and develop welding skills and cross-training opportunities across both shifts
Develop and document departmental best practices and standard operating procedures
Qualifications:
5+ years of welding leadership experience supervising a team of 10 or more welders
Ability to read and comprehend engineering drawings, prints, weld callouts, job travelers, and work instructions
Exceptional interpersonal and written communication skills
Demonstrated ability to lead and motivate an experienced team to meet and exceed performance expectations
Passion for production output, continuous improvement, planning, organization, and operational efficiency
Strong welding skills sufficient to support the development and training of welders
Experience with or aptitude for working with ERP systems for production transactions
Proficient in basic computer skills and basic math, including geometry, fractions, and decimals
